National School Choice Week (January 22-28, 2017) is a positive and enthusiastic celebration of all educational options, including private, religious education. As a longtime supporter of school choice, Agudath Israel of America has been an active participant since the first NSCW and welcomes your participation. Already, more than 18,000 events are being planned for NSCW 2017, many of them featuring the ubiquitous yellow scarves. NCSW is nonpolitical and does not advocate for any specific legislation, however statehouse rallies and community events are great opportunities to educate families and lawmakers about existing school choice programs or why such policies should be pursued.
